University of Maryland President Wallace D. Loh on Tuesday said the school "accepts legal and moral responsibility for the mistakes" made by its athletic training staff at a workout on May 29 that ultimately led to the death of 19-year-old offensive lineman Jordan McNair from heatstroke.http://www.espn.com/college-footbal...ponsibility-mistakes-made-death-jordan-mcnair
